Least Common Multiple of 99402 and 99412 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 99402 and 99412, than apply into the LCM equation.

GCF(99402,99412) = 2
LCM(99402,99412) = ( 99402 × 99412) / 2
LCM(99402,99412) = 9881751624 / 2
LCM(99402,99412) = 4940875812
